About this campaign

one tough mother- Molly Lane
Molly and Jacob Lane III have been in Seattle since welcoming their baby, Kayuqtuq Aaron Donald Lane on August 6th, 2025. Kayuqtuk was born 10 weeks premature and only weighed 2lbs, 5oz. He was also born with Down Syndrome which caused him to have additional health issues. He has Hirschsprung's disease which led him to have surgery on his intestines at 3 months old. He was also born with two holes in his heart and received open heart surgery at 4 months old. He is currently 8 months old and has been hospitalized his entire life. He still needs a couple more surgeries to repair his intestines and insert a feeding tube. Because he was born early, he also has complications with his lungs. These complications caused his veins to his heart to narrow and also caused high blood pressure in his lungs. The doctors say that the combination of all his issues is rare. He is currently on breathing support and will likely need it for many months to come. Despite all the health problems Kayuqtuq has, he has continued to be a smiley and happy baby, winning the hearts of everyone who cares for him.

Molly and Jacob have been by baby Kayuqtuq's side the entire time and have had to endure being many miles away from the comforts of home, away from their older kids and away from the culture.

Now is your chance to support Molly as one tough mother, and purchase a t-shirt or sweater. 100% of the proceeds from this fundraiser will go to Molly and Jacob to help alleviate their financial burden of being away from home and caring for their baby.
